What is an SS316 Rotary Gear Pump? โ€” Overview

An SS316 rotary gear pump is a type of positive displacement pump designed to move fluids by the meshing of rotating gears. In this specific configuration, the pump casing and its internal components, including the gears, are constructed from SS316 stainless steel. This grade of stainless steel offers superior resistance to a wide range of corrosive chemicals and high temperatures compared to standard SS304. As the gears rotate, they create cavities that fill with fluid; as the gears unmesh, the fluid is pushed out of the discharge port, ensuring a continuous and steady flow rate irrespective of system pressure variations.

Key Features and Technical Specifications

  • Material Construction: Entirely fabricated from SS316 stainless steel for exceptional corrosion and chemical resistance.
  • Positive Displacement Mechanism: Ensures a constant flow rate per revolution, ideal for metering and precise transfer.
  • Gear Design: Precision-machined gears for optimal sealing, efficiency, and minimal fluid shear.
  • Sealing Options: Available with various seal types, including mechanical seals and gland packing, to suit different media and operating conditions.
  • Viscosity Handling: Capable of pumping highly viscous liquids, pastes, and slurries effectively.
  • Temperature Range: Suitable for operation across a broad temperature spectrum, often up to 150ยฐC or higher depending on configuration.
  • Hygiene Standards: SS316 material makes it suitable for hygienic applications in food and pharmaceutical industries.
  • Robust Casing: Designed to withstand moderate to high pressures encountered in industrial processes.

Industrial Applications and Use Cases

  • Chemical Processing: Transferring corrosive acids, alkalis, solvents, and various chemical intermediates.
  • Pharmaceuticals: Metering and transferring active pharmaceutical ingredients (APIs), excipients, and viscous formulations.
  • Food & Beverage: Pumping edible oils, syrups, chocolate, molasses, and other viscous food products while maintaining hygiene.
  • Petrochemicals: Handling oils, lubricants, fuels, and other petroleum-based products.
  • Paints & Coatings: Transferring viscous paints, inks, resins, and adhesives.
  • Cosmetics: Pumping lotions, creams, and other viscous cosmetic formulations.
  • Polymer Manufacturing: Transferring molten polymers and viscous resins.
  • Wastewater Treatment: Pumping sludge and viscous effluent in specialized applications.

How to Choose the Right SS316 Rotary Gear Pump

Selecting the appropriate SS316 rotary gear pump is crucial for ensuring optimal performance and longevity. Consider these factors:

  • Fluid Properties: Analyze viscosity, temperature, corrosivity, and presence of solids in the fluid to be pumped.
  • Flow Rate and Pressure: Determine the required discharge rate and the maximum system pressure.
  • Material Compatibility: Confirm that SS316 is suitable for the specific chemicals being handled.
  • Seal Type: Choose between mechanical seals or gland packing based on fluid characteristics and safety requirements.
  • Motor and Drive: Select an appropriate motor and drive system (e.g., VFD) for speed control and power requirements.
  • Certifications: Verify if the pump meets industry-specific standards (e.g., ATEX for hazardous areas, FDA for food contact).

Quality Standards and Compliance

When procuring an SS316 rotary gear pump, adherence to stringent quality standards is non-negotiable. Look for manufacturers who comply with international standards like ISO 9001 for quality management systems. For specific applications, compliance with standards such as ASME for pressure vessel design, or ATEX directives for equipment used in potentially explosive atmospheres, is vital. The material certification for SS316 should be readily available, verifying its chemical composition and mechanical properties. Reputable suppliers will also provide performance test reports and ensure their manufacturing processes meet industry best practices for precision and reliability.

Installation, Maintenance, and Care Tips

Proper installation and regular maintenance are key to maximizing the lifespan and performance of your SS316 rotary gear pump.

Installation

Ensure the pump is installed on a solid, level foundation to minimize vibration.

Align the pump and motor shafts accurately to prevent premature wear on seals and bearings.

Connect piping securely, avoiding any strain on the pump casing.

Prime the pump before initial startup, especially if handling volatile fluids.

Maintenance

Regularly inspect for leaks around seals and connections.

Monitor pump operating temperature and vibration levels.

Check lubrication levels for bearings and gearboxes as per manufacturer recommendations.

Clean strainers and filters periodically to prevent blockages.

Follow a scheduled maintenance program for seal replacement and internal inspections.

Care:

Avoid running the pump dry, as this can damage seals and gears.

Do not operate the pump against a closed discharge valve for extended periods.

Ensure the fluid being pumped is within the pump's specified viscosity and temperature limits.

  • Use only approved lubricants and spare parts.

While SS316 offers good corrosion resistance, it is not inherently designed for highly abrasive slurries. For such applications, specialized hardened materials or specific gear designs might be necessary. However, for moderately abrasive fluids or those containing fine particulates, SS316 pumps can perform adequately with appropriate seal selection and maintenance.

The operating pressure range for SS316 rotary gear pumps can vary significantly based on the specific design, size, and manufacturer. Generally, they are capable of handling pressures from a few bar up to 20 bar or more, making them suitable for many industrial process requirements. It is essential to consult the pump's specifications for its exact pressure limits.

Rotary gear pumps are positive displacement devices. This means they trap a fixed volume of fluid with each rotation of the gears. As a result, the flow rate is directly proportional to the pump's speed, providing a consistent and predictable output, which is crucial for accurate metering and dosing applications.

SS316 rotary gear pumps are well-suited for high-viscosity fluids, often handling liquids with viscosities up to tens of thousands of centipoise (cP). The exact limit depends on the pump's design, motor power, and the operating temperature, as viscosity decreases with increasing temperature.

Seals are critical components and require regular inspection for wear, leakage, or hardening. Depending on the fluid and operating conditions, seals may need replacement periodically. Following the manufacturer's recommended maintenance schedule for seal inspection and replacement is vital to prevent pump damage and ensure operational reliability.
